Alvin Toffler Quotes
Brief author info: Alvin Toffler (1928- ) American writer.
Showing: 1 - 7 Alvin Toffler Quotes of 7
Parenthood remains the greatest single preserve of the amateur.
Future shock: the shattering stress and disorientation that we induce in individuals by subjecting them to too much change in too short a time.
Anyone nit-picking enough to write a letter of correction to an editor doubtless deserves the error that provokes it.
The illiterate of the twenty-first century will not be those who cannot read and write, but those who cannot learn, unlearn and relearn.
The law of raspberry jam: The wider any culture is spread, the thinner it gets.
It is better to err on the side of daring than on the side of caution.
